3. Blood type is inherited. If both parents carry genes for the O and A blood types (i. e.,
Phenotype Type A, or Genotype AO), a Punnett Square such as the one below can help
determine the probability of a particular blood type for each child. O is a recessive gene,
meaning that the only way to have Type O blood is to have the genotype 00. What is the
probability of the following?
i. Child has Type O blood? (1 point)
ii. Child has Type A blood (any genotype)? (1 point)
iii. Child has Type A blood and cannot have children with Type O blood? (1
point)
iv. Child has Type A blood and can have children with Type O blood? (1
point)
b. This couple had 4 children. this exercise, we are considering the number of
children with Type O blood.
i. What is success in this exercise? What is the probability of success, p? (2
points)
ii. What kind of probability distribution is this exercise? Explain your
reasoning. (5 points)
